- FrameGrabber is a black external box which connects to the
- Amiga's parallel port and monitor and lets you capture
- color or grayscale or monochrome images from still or moving
- video inputs. This means it has an NTSC composite-IN jack on
- it into which you can plug a video camera, camcorder, still
- video camera (Xapshot, Mavica, etc.), laserdisc player, a VCR;s
- outputs or a TV tuner.
-
- When you see something you want to grab on your monitor you
- hit one key and the image is grabbed and stored to memory
- or disk. Depending on the speed of your Amiga and the size
- of the image, you can also grab moving sequences for animations.
- FrameGrabber is *NOT* a slow-scan digitizer like Digiview or DCTV.
- It grabs instantly, in 1/30th of a second.
-
- Besides support from its included software, both ADPro 2.5 and
- ImageFX 2.1 (and perhaps other versions of both) include a
- FrameGrabber driver and both are even more full featured
- than the original software that comes with the unit. (ADPro and
- ImageFX are NOT included in this sale).
